2011 IOM Worlds Championship.

Wednesday, June 15th, 2011

IOM ICA wish to congratulate MYA, West Kirby Sailing Club, their volunteers and the organizing committee for the great event we have just finished in West Kirby.

We would like also to congratulate Peter Stollery (GBR) and Brad Gibson (GBR) for their performance in all conditions of wind and waves and also for their demonstration of sportsmanship at a high level. With his consistent sailing throughout the week, Peter demonstrated that he is a worthy IOM World Champion.

 

2011 marks the first year for the Geoff Smale Memorial Corinthian Spirit award. In this first year the award has been presented to Bill Butler (AUS) for his demonstration of fair sailing. Congratulations to Bill.

The winner of the Masters award for 2011 was Graham Bantock who continues to sail at a high level in our major events.

IOM ICA is currently discussing the options for the 2012 Europeans with 2 countries (Israel and Spain), and is ready to welcome applications for hosting the 2013 Worlds.

2011 IOM World Championship. Drop out guidance

Monday, March 21st, 2011

The Organising Authority has been asked whether NCA’s can substitute another competitor if one of their competitors who are included in the 76 entered boats has to drop out. In the absence of any guidance from the IOMICA Class Championship Rules, the Organising Authority and IOMICA are giving the following clarification/ruling on how drop outs will be dealt with.

2011 IOM World Championships. Allocation of places.

Tuesday, December 21st, 2010

Allocation of places for the IOM 2011 World Championship in Great Britain Taken from IOM Class Championship Rules
The maximum number of boats shall be 76.
The initial closing date shall be February 27th, 2011.
The allocation of places shall take place by March, 12th 2011.
